Electrical Engineer - Power Systems

AECOM is a global infrastructure consulting firm committed to delivering a better world. They are seeking an experienced Electrical Engineer with a strong background in Power Systems to support Energy Transition projects, focusing on grid modernization, project leadership, and stakeholder engagement.
